Taxonomic Classification

Rank Eurasian Reed Warbler Lime Bent-wing
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Aves (Birds) Insecta (Insects)
Order Passeriformes (Songbirds)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ths)
Family Acrocephalidae Bucculatricidae
Genus Acrocephalus Bucculatrix
Species Acrocephalus scirpaceus Bucculatrix thoracella

Evolutionary Relationship

Eurasian Reed Warbler and Lime Bent-wing share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
